Album Notes

As "Jazz Times" stated : "In all, it's a cocky strut down fusion's wild side!"

The "Fusion" album sends you into another fantasy; this time to different lands across the globe: Spain, Mexico, China, a visit to the Caribbean islands, and also a detour to another dimension - "The Twilight Zone" - Mike's tribute to Rod Serling and basically the story of Mike's life - is this reality or the Twilight Zone?

This project is totally different from his first album - "Island Fantasy". It shows Mike's tremendous diversity - allowing him to fuse a very eclectic blend of: Jazz, Rock, Classical and Pop musics to display his prowess in composition and his mastery of the guitar in various settings from mellowness to wild intensity!
